Mesothelioma Claims

A mesothelioma suit is a legal action to seek financial compensation for asbestos-related victims. Compensation is awarded through a mesothelioma suit, a mesothelioma settlement, or an asbestos trust fund award.

The process is often complicated and long, but a good law firm will make it easier for the victims. Compensation can be used to cover medical expenses as well as other costs associated with mesothelioma case.

Time limit

The time period for mesothelioma cases is determined by a range of factors. The date of diagnosis, as well as the extent of exposure are key factors. According to law, victims must file their lawsuits within the period of limitation, or risk losing compensation rights. To avoid not meeting the deadline, patients must consult a seasoned mesothelioma lawyer as quickly as they can.

The mesothelioma statute of limitation differs from state to state. The majority of mesothelioma case cases must be filed between one and three years following the diagnosis or death of the patient. This is because mesothelioma, and other asbestos-related ailments, have a lengthy latency.

In addition to mesothelioma cases, some victims may also be entitled to compensation through trust funds or veterans' benefits. These options typically go through faster than a mesothelioma lawsuit and some may not require the filing of lawsuits.

Financial losses

The medical expenses related to the treatment of mesothelioma could cause financial hardships for asbestos victims and their family members. This is especially true if the patient or family member is not able to work because of their illness. This is because it is very hard to focus on your job while you are undergoing chemotherapy and other treatments. Many patients and their families do not get on the money they could have earned if they were healthy enough to to work.

In addition to the financial losses that mesothelioma patients suffer, their families, they also suffer emotional distress and pain. They are entitled to compensation for their loss. This is why it's essential to file a mesothelioma lawsuit. Compensation can be in the form of compensatory damages. These are intended to be paid to the victim and to pay for the expenses they've incurred due to the mesothelioma.

Compensation for mesothelioma can be obtained from many sources that include asbestos companies insurance policies, trust funds, and trust funds. Veterans Affairs also offers compensation to veterans who have suffered from mesothelioma as a result of asbestos exposure during their time in the military.

A mesothelioma law company can help victims and their families find the most suitable source of compensation for their losses. They can assist families and patients determine the best place to file a claim based on locations of asbestos companies that they believe to be responsible. They can also help them complete the necessary paperwork and ensure that the claims are filed on time.

Although a mesothelioma suit will not completely reverse the consequences of a mesothelioma diagnosis, it can help ease some of the stress and financial burdens. Compensation from a lawsuit could cover medical costs and lost income, and provide financial support for loved ones.
